Purple Afghan

Afghan in Two Shades of Purple
Sadie made this afghan for me around 1970, to go with my lavender bedroom. It traveled with me from Wilmington to Boston and from Boston to Albuquerque. After 30 years of hard use, I feared that one more round of kneading by a happy cat would cause my purple treasure to unravel, so I reluctantly took it out of service. Then my mother-in-law Maybelle Johnson labored over it for many hours while visiting Albuquerque in 2003, restoring/repairing the afghan to near-original condition. Thank you, Maybelle! -- Zelda
